Sustainable Finance: A Growing Force in Global Markets

Sustainable finance continues to become a major force in global markets. Investors are increasingly seeking investments that align with environmental, social, and governance (ESG) standards. This trend is driven by a increasing awareness of the impact of financial decisions on sustainability and the need to address global challenges such as climate change.

As a result, there has been rapid growth in sustainable finance initiatives. Investors are turning to sustainable funds to support sustainable businesses. Governments and regulatory bodies are also enacting policies to promote sustainable finance practices. The future of finance is unmistakably linked with sustainability, and this trend is progressing momentum worldwide.
